Explore the groundbreaking ideas of Henri Bergson with "A New Philosophy: Henri Bergson," a foundational text in French philosophy and metaphysics. This insightful work by Edouard le Roy delves into the core of Bergson's thought, offering readers a comprehensive introduction to his revolutionary concepts.

A key figure in 20th-century philosophy, Bergson challenged traditional approaches to time, consciousness, and evolution. Le Roy's exploration illuminates Bergson's distinctive perspective, making his complex theories accessible to a broader audience.

Whether you are a student of philosophy or simply curious about the evolution of modern thought, this book provides a valuable entry point into the world of Bergson's enduring influence.
